498- Building a College-Readiness Timeline for Teens with ADHD
from ADHD Experts Podcast
College prep looks different for teens with ADHD, who may lag behind in independent living skills and college readiness. Laura Barr, M.Ed., provides a clear roadmap for teens and parents, including milestones, practical steps, and launch and college timeline checklists.
